For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 166 students in 58545, ND.
The top ranked public high school in 58545, ND is Hazen High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
ºÚÁÏÍø¹ÙÍø high school in zipcode 58545 have an average math proficiency score of 35% (versus the North Dakota public high school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 65% (versus the 46% statewide average). High schools in 58545, ND have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of North Dakota public high schools.
ºÚÁÏÍø¹ÙÍø high school in zipcode 58545 have a Graduation Rate of 90%, which is more than the North Dakota average of 79%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Hazen High School, with ≥90%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in North Dakota or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 17%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the North Dakota public high school average of 28% (majority American Indian).
